Ch 15 Probability(Std 10) Question 17

(1) a lot of 20 bulbs contain 4 defective ones one bulb is drawn at random from the lot what is the probability that this bulb is defective?

(2)Suppose the bulb drawn in no 1.. is not defective and is not replaced . what is the probability that this bulb is not defective ?​

Step-by-step explanation:

1. There are total 20 bulbs and 4 of them are defective

So the probability of drawing a defective one is: 4/20 =1/5

2. Since a non defective bulb is removed,the total number of bulbs will become 19 and defective ones will remain 4, so the proper bulbs are 15 now

Now, the probability of drawing a defective one is: 4/19
